If you’re craving a cozy, home-cooked Italian classic that’ll wow your family and friends, look no further than this Spaghetti with Giant Meatballs Recipe. It’s the perfect balance of tender, juicy meatballs simmered in a rich, buttery tomato sauce, all tossed with perfectly cooked spaghetti. This dish captures the essence of comfort food with every bite, making it a truly unforgettable meal that feels like a warm embrace on a plate. Trust me, once you make this, it’ll become your go-to recipe for special dinners or Sunday family feasts.

Ingredients You’ll Need

This image shows a silver pot filled with five browned meat patties sitting in a smooth, bright orange sauce. The meat patties have a slightly crispy texture on top with some green herb bits visible on their surface. The sauce looks thick and creamy, covering the bottom of the pot evenly. A silver spoon is partially submerged in the sauce near the front of the pot. The pot is placed on a white marbled surface, and in the background, there are two round containers, one with a yellow liquid and another with salt crystals. Photo taken with an iphone --ar 4:5 --v 7

Gathering simple, quality ingredients is key to making this dish sing in flavor and texture. Each item here plays an essential role—from the juicy beef and veal in the meatballs to the fresh parsley adding brightness and the rich tomato sauce that ties it all together.

  • 2 28-oz cans whole peeled tomatoes: These form the base of the luscious tomato sauce, bringing a natural sweetness and slight acidity.
  • 1 stick unsalted butter: Adds creaminess and balances the acidity in the sauce for a velvety finish.
  • 1 onion, peeled and halved: Infuses the sauce with a subtle, aromatic sweetness as it simmers gently.
  • 1 tsp kosher salt: Enhances every flavor in the meatballs and sauce alike.
  • ¼ tsp freshly ground black pepper: Provides just the right hint of spice to keep things interesting.
  • 2 large eggs, beaten: Help bind the meatball mixture together for perfect texture.
  • ½ cup whole milk: Keeps the meatballs moist and tender inside.
  • 1 cup fresh breadcrumbs (or panko): Adds structure and a light bite to the giant meatballs.
  • 1 small garlic clove, mashed into a paste: Contributes a punch of savory aroma that’s simply irresistible.
  • 2 tbsp chopped fresh parsley: Brings a green freshness that brightens the rich meat mixture.
  • 2 tsp kosher salt: Essential for seasoning the meatballs thoroughly.
  • 1 tsp freshly ground black pepper: Adds depth and a subtle bite to the meatballs.
  • ½ lb lean ground beef (90/10): Offers rich flavor with just the right fat content for juicy meatballs.
  • ½ lb ground veal: Brings tenderness and delicate flavor that complements the beef perfectly.
  • 1 cup grated parmesan, plus more for serving: Infuses the meatballs with a savory, cheesy depth.
  • Olive oil, for frying: Ensures a crispy, golden crust on the giant meatballs.
  • 1 lb spaghetti: The perfect pasta to soak up every bit of that heavenly sauce.

How to Make Spaghetti with Giant Meatballs Recipe

Step 1: Prepare the Tomato Sauce

Start by pouring the whole peeled tomatoes into a large pot along with the onion halves and a stick of unsalted butter. Bring the mixture to a simmer, and let it cook on low heat, breaking the tomatoes apart with the back of a spoon as they soften. Season with kosher salt and freshly ground black pepper, allowing the flavors to meld into a smooth, rich sauce. This slow simmering creates the most comforting base for your meatballs to swim in.

Step 2: Mix the Meatball Ingredients

In a large bowl, whisk the eggs with whole milk until combined. Add fresh breadcrumbs, mashed garlic, chopped parsley, kosher salt, and black pepper, mixing well to combine. Then gently fold in the lean ground beef, ground veal, and grated parmesan. Be careful not to overwork the mixture; you want tender meatballs, not tough ones! This careful balance ensures juicy giants that stay moist after cooking.

Step 3: Shape and Fry the Giant Meatballs

Divide your meat mixture into large, generous portions and gently form each into a big, round meatball. Heat olive oil in a heavy skillet over medium heat, then carefully add the meatballs, frying until they develop a beautiful golden crust on all sides. This step locks in juices and adds a wonderful texture contrast to the tender meat inside.

Step 4: Simmer the Meatballs in Sauce

Transfer the fried meatballs to the simmering tomato sauce. Let them bubble away gently for 30 to 40 minutes so they can finish cooking inside while soaking up the sauce’s incredible flavors. This step is where magic happens and the meatballs get truly tender and infused with deep tomato richness.

Step 5: Cook the Spaghetti

Meanwhile, bring a large pot of salted water to a boil and cook your spaghetti according to package instructions until al dente. Drain the pasta, reserving a bit of the pasta water in case you want to loosen up the sauce later. The spaghetti is ready to carry the hearty sauce and giant meatballs to your plate.

How to Serve Spaghetti with Giant Meatballs Recipe

A white plate holds a visually appealing serving of spaghetti with tomato sauce, arranged in a loose nest-like shape. On top of the spaghetti sits a single large meatball coated in rich red sauce, sprinkled with thin white shavings of cheese. Small green basil leaves are placed near the edges of the plate for color contrast. A fork lies on the right side of the plate, resting partially over the spaghetti. The scene is set on a white marbled surface with a light gray cloth on the left, a glass of water at the top right, a metal grater with a block of cheese at the bottom left, and a small bowl of salt nearby. Photo taken with an iphone --ar 4:5 --v 7

Garnishes

Sprinkle freshly grated parmesan over the top for that nutty, salty sparkle that makes every bite sing. Add a handful of chopped fresh parsley for color and a bright herbal note. If you like a little heat, a pinch of crushed red pepper flakes lifts the dish beautifully too.

Side Dishes

A crisp green salad dressed with lemon vinaigrette creates a refreshing counterpoint to the richness of the meatballs and sauce. Garlic bread or warm focaccia is perfect for soaking up every last drop of that luscious tomato sauce. Roasted seasonal vegetables provide extra color and texture for a well-rounded, satisfying meal.

Creative Ways to Present

Try serving each giant meatball perched on a bed of twirled spaghetti on individual plates to wow your guests. Or go family-style by placing the saucy meatballs in a large rustic bowl center-table with pasta piled high around them—everyone can dig in and share the joy of this hearty classic together.

Make Ahead and Storage

Storing Leftovers

Keep any leftover meatballs and sauce together in an airtight container in the refrigerator. They will maintain their flavor and texture best if eaten within three to four days, giving you a delicious second chance to enjoy this wonderful dish.

Freezing

This Spaghetti with Giant Meatballs Recipe freezes beautifully. Place the cooked meatballs and sauce in a freezer-safe container or bag and freeze for up to three months. When you’re ready, thaw overnight in the fridge before reheating for a quick, satisfying meal.

Reheating

Reheat meatballs and sauce gently on the stovetop over low to medium heat, stirring occasionally until warmed through to avoid drying out. If needed, add a splash of pasta water to loosen the sauce. For the spaghetti, a quick zap in the microwave sprinkled with a little water keeps it soft and ready to go.

FAQs

Can I use all beef instead of beef and veal in the meatballs?

Absolutely. Using all beef is fine if veal isn’t available, but the veal adds a tender, delicate texture that balances the beef’s richness. If you use all beef, aim for a mix of lean and slightly fattier ground beef for juiciness.

How do I keep my giant meatballs from falling apart?

Be sure not to overmix the ingredients when combining, as this can make them dense and prone to crumbling. Using eggs and breadcrumbs in the right proportions helps bind everything together, plus carefully handling the meatballs when frying and simmering them gently in sauce keeps them intact.

Can I make the sauce ahead of time?

Yes! The tomato sauce can be made a day or two ahead. In fact, the flavors deepen beautifully when it has time to rest. Just reheat gently before adding the meatballs for simmering.

What type of pasta is best for this recipe?

Classic spaghetti is a natural choice, but you can also use other long pasta like linguine or bucatini. The key is picking a pasta that can hold up to the weight and richness of these giant meatballs and thick tomato sauce.

Is this recipe suitable for freezing leftovers?

Definitely. Both the meatballs and sauce freeze well, making this a perfect make-ahead meal. Just thaw slowly in the fridge before warming up to preserve texture and flavor.

Final Thoughts

Making this Spaghetti with Giant Meatballs Recipe is like inviting Italian comfort straight into your kitchen. The tender, flavorful meatballs and rich tomato sauce wrapped around perfectly cooked spaghetti create a meal that feels both special and familiar. I can’t recommend enough giving this recipe a try—it’s sure to become a beloved staple on your dinner table and a source of countless happy memories.

Print

Spaghetti with Giant Meatballs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

4.2 from 88 reviews

A classic Italian-American dish featuring tender giant meatballs made from a blend of ground beef and veal, simmered in a rich homemade tomato sauce and served over perfectly cooked spaghetti. This comforting recipe balances flavorful meatballs with a buttery, savory tomato sauce for a satisfying family meal.

  • Author: Julia
  • Prep Time: 20 minutes
  • Cook Time: 1 hour 15 minutes
  • Total Time: 1 hour 35 minutes
  • Yield: 6 servings
  • Category: Main Course
  • Method: Frying
  • Cuisine: Italian-American

Ingredients

Tomato Sauce

  • 2 (28-oz) cans whole peeled tomatoes
  • 1 stick unsalted butter
  • 1 onion, peeled and halved
  • 1 tsp kosher salt
  • ¼ tsp freshly ground black pepper

Giant Meatballs

  • 2 large eggs, beaten
  • ½ cup whole milk
  • 1 cup fresh breadcrumbs (can substitute panko)
  • 1 small garlic clove, mashed into a paste
  • 2 tbsp chopped fresh parsley
  • 2 tsp kosher salt
  • 1 tsp freshly ground black pepper
  • ½ lb lean ground beef (90/10)
  • ½ lb ground veal
  • 1 cup grated parmesan, plus more for serving
  • Olive oil, for frying

Pasta

  • 1 lb spaghetti

Instructions

  1. Prepare the Tomato Sauce: In a large pot or saucepan, add the cans of whole peeled tomatoes, the halved onion, butter, kosher salt, and black pepper. Bring the mixture to a simmer over medium heat and allow it to cook gently, breaking down the tomatoes with a spoon, until the sauce thickens and flavors meld, about 45 minutes. Remove the onion halves before serving.
  2. Make the Meatball Mixture: In a large bowl, combine the beaten eggs, whole milk, fresh breadcrumbs, garlic paste, chopped fresh parsley, kosher salt, and black pepper. Add the ground beef and ground veal along with the grated parmesan cheese. Mix gently until just combined to avoid tough meatballs.
  3. Shape and Fry the Meatballs: Form the mixture into large, golf-ball-sized meatballs. Heat a generous amount of olive oil in a large skillet over medium heat. Fry the meatballs in batches until they develop a golden-brown crust on all sides, about 7-8 minutes, turning carefully to avoid breaking. Transfer the browned meatballs to the simmering tomato sauce and cook together for an additional 20 minutes to finish cooking through and absorb the sauce’s flavor.
  4. Cook the Spaghetti: Bring a large pot of salted water to a boil and cook the spaghetti according to the package instructions until al dente, usually about 8-10 minutes. Drain well.
  5. Serve: Plate the spaghetti and top with the giant meatballs and plenty of tomato sauce. Garnish with extra grated parmesan cheese and fresh parsley if desired. Serve immediately while hot.

Notes

  • For a richer sauce, consider simmering the tomatoes longer to reduce and concentrate flavors.
  • Fresh breadcrumbs provide a tender texture to the meatballs, but panko can be used if unavailable.
  • Be careful not to overmix the meat mixture to keep meatballs tender.
  • Maintain a moderate oil temperature to ensure meatballs brown evenly without burning.
  • Make sure to drain pasta well to prevent watering down the sauce upon serving.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star